After having the chance to own both the FRS and the Brz, this car has been a blast to own. Both car was pretty much stock besides an invidia exhaust and small little diys. I have own the brz/frs platform for about a good 2 years combined and the driving experience was amazing!
Would I buy this car again in the future? Yes, i would because the driving experience is unlike no other in its price range. This car would be perfect for those live in places with a lot of curvy roads. Imagine this, 6pm on a warm sunny day, driving on a quiet isolated road with the beauty of nature surrounding you. You accelerate faster and faster on every curve not fearing for your life because you know that your car can handle anything you throw at it. This experience is pretty much pure bliss for me! I don't get as much excitement driving my cousin's Mustang 5.0 on the same winding road. Pros? *SHARP handling! *Great gas mileage (I get around 30mpg) *Design of the car (Just look at it! It turns heads where ever you go!) *Interior is well designed (This applies more towards the BRZ limited) *Steering wheel is very responsive (drift all day looooong) *Manual transmission is better than its competitors *The mod community (All i have to say is wow.... This car has so much support compared to other cars. I have a 2006 mazda mx5 and i cant even find one damn aftermarket part that looks good. I needed one headlight and its cost $700 at the dealers for ONE headlight with no aftermarket support!) *Seats 4 (well more like 2 adults and 2 gremlins but hey it works :bonk:) *Alot more features and aspects that i like about the car but you guys who own this car will already know about it. Cons!? *Fuel pump (Crickets everywhere! It chirps alot. Simple fix : Exhaust upgrade) *Horsepower(:popcorn: Handling makes up for it:lol:) *Frs interior(too plain esp those with the older models. 4 knobs and some radio buttons. Get the BRZ Limited if you care about the interior) *Torque dip ($500 fix) Overall this car is a great DD and you won't go wrong if you decided to purchase it! Just remember that there are cons and pros of every car, only you can make it perfect since everyone has their own preference! Why am i getting rid of it?
